Beigang

Beigang offers a distinct cultural and historical experience, particularly known for its religious heritage and traditional arts. The area is home to the famous Chaotian Temple, a significant pilgrimage site that draws visitors from across Taiwan and Asia. For international travellers interested in experiencing Taiwan's rich spiritual traditions and historical architecture, Beigang provides a unique and immersive opportunity. The atmosphere here is more serene and traditional compared to the bustling city centres.

Accommodations in Beigang tend to be more modest, with guesthouses and smaller hotels reflecting the area's traditional character. The local cuisine is also a highlight, with Beigang famous for its traditional snacks and seafood. Getting to Beigang is typically done via bus from larger transport hubs like Douliu. Exploring Beigang allows for a deeper understanding of Taiwanese folk culture and religious practices, offering a peaceful retreat for those seeking a more contemplative travel experience.

Xiluo

Xiluo is a charming riverside town renowned for its historic Xiluo Bridge and its relaxed, community-focused atmosphere. It offers a picturesque setting, particularly appealing to travellers looking for a quieter escape with scenic views and a slower pace of life. The town’s connection to the river and its historical significance as a trading post lend it a unique character that stands out from more urbanized areas. It’s a place where you can experience a more intimate side of Taiwanese life.

In Xiluo, accommodation options lean towards guesthouses and smaller inns, providing a cozy and local feel. The town is also celebrated for its local produce and traditional snacks, making it a delightful spot for food enthusiasts. Transportation to Xiluo is usually by bus from nearby cities. The area is perfect for leisurely strolls, enjoying the river views, and experiencing the warmth of a close-knit Taiwanese community, offering a tranquil counterpoint to busier destinations.

Gukeng

Gukeng is primarily known as Taiwan's "coffee capital" and a popular destination for its natural beauty, particularly its hot springs and lush landscapes. This area offers a refreshing escape into nature, appealing to travellers seeking relaxation and outdoor activities. The mountainous terrain and the focus on agricultural products like coffee and bamboo create a distinct rural charm that is a significant draw for both domestic and international visitors looking for a serene retreat.

Accommodations in Gukeng range from charming bed and breakfasts to resorts offering hot spring facilities, catering to those seeking a relaxing getaway. The local cuisine features specialties made with local ingredients, including coffee-infused dishes and bamboo-based meals. Gukeng is accessible by bus from Douliu and other major towns. It’s an ideal location for those who wish to unwind, enjoy scenic drives, indulge in spa treatments, and experience Taiwan's natural beauty.

Dining in Huwei offers excellent value for international travellers. Street food snacks can be enjoyed for as little as ₱ 50-100 (approximately $1.50-$3 USD), while a meal at a mid-range restaurant typically costs between ₱ 300-600 (approximately $9-$18 USD). Even more upscale dining experiences remain affordable compared to Western standards, with a three-course meal for two at a good restaurant rarely exceeding ₱ 2,000 (approximately $60 USD). This affordability allows travellers to indulge in the local cuisine extensively.

When dining in Huwei, it's helpful to be aware of local customs. Meal times are generally similar to Western schedules, with lunch around noon and dinner from 6 PM to 8 PM. Tipping is not customary in Taiwan; the service charge is usually included in the bill. It's polite to wait for your host to begin eating, and finishing your plate is seen as a sign of appreciation for the food. Learning a few basic Mandarin phrases for ordering food can also enhance your dining experience and show respect for the local culture.

Huwei is considered a very safe destination for travellers. However, as with any travel, it's wise to take precautions with your valuables, especially in crowded markets or on public transport. Ride-hailing apps are available, though local taxi services are also reliable and generally affordable. For navigation, offline map applications are highly recommended, as is a local SIM card for constant connectivity. Staying aware of your surroundings and keeping your hotel details handy are basic but effective safety practices.

In case of emergencies, the general emergency number in Taiwan is 110 for police and 119 for fire and ambulance services. To reach Huwei from the Philippines, you'll typically fly from Manila (NAIA/MNL) or Cebu (CEB) to Taiwan Taoyuan International Airport (TPE) near Taipei, or potentially to Kaohsiung International Airport (KHH) in southern Taiwan. Direct flights are less common to smaller regional airports, so connecting flights are more likely. From the main Taiwanese airports, you can take a high-speed rail (HSR) or regular train to Douliu, which is a major transport hub for Huwei. The total travel time, including transfers, can range from 8 to 12 hours. You can book flight tickets well in advance for better prices.

Once you are in the Huwei region, getting around is convenient and affordable. Local buses connect the various towns and districts, including Huwei, Douliu, and Beigang. Taxis are readily available, and ride-hailing apps can also be used. For exploring within towns, renting a scooter is an option for licensed riders, or simply enjoying leisurely walks is recommended in more compact areas. The HSR and regular train lines are excellent for longer distances between cities within Taiwan.

The best time to visit Huwei generally falls during the spring (March to May) and autumn (September to November) months. During these periods, the weather is pleasant, with mild temperatures and lower humidity, making it ideal for outdoor exploration. Summer can be hot and humid with a risk of typhoons, while winter is cooler but generally dry. These shoulder seasons often coincide with fewer crowds and potentially lower accommodation prices, offering a more relaxed experience for international visitors.

Philippine passport holders are generally eligible for visa-free entry into Taiwan for tourism purposes, typically for a stay of up to 14 days. However, this visa-free status is subject to certain conditions and can change. Key requirements usually include a passport valid for at least six months beyond your intended stay, a confirmed return ticket, and proof of accommodation or sufficient financial means. It is imperative to check the official website of Taiwan's Bureau of Consular Affairs or the nearest Taipei Economic and Cultural Office (TECO) for the most current regulations and any specific documentation needed.
